‘Riverdale’ is Getting a Second Spinoff at CW

By Sara Roncero-MenendezAugust 8, 2018

Riverdale is one of those shows no one thought was going to live through an entire season, and yet has now inspired two spinoffs. The first is the highly anticipated The Chilling Adventures of Sabrina, based on the popular comic by Riverdale showrunner Roberto Aguirre-Sacasa. But now there’s going to be a second spinoff  for the CW.

“Right now, we’re trying to make sure that the shows have their own identity and their own set of rules,” Aguirre-Sacasa revealed at the Television Critics Association summer press tour. “We’re still early on in the process and it will be very different from ‘Riverdale.’ ”

But sadly, that’s all the information we got about it. There are a lot of theories floating around, like following Josie and the Pussycats, looking the parents of Riverdale when they were in high school, or a look at the mafia subplot that runs through the show. Still, it will likely be tied to an already existing Archie property, so don’t expect too much out of left field. Hopefully they’ll stick to their word and go in a really different direction than what we’ve seen so far.

Until then, October is a big month for Riverdale fans. Riverdale Season 3 premieres on October 3rd on CW. The Chilling Adventures of Sabrina premieres on Netflix on October 26th.
